Pagina 1 di 2

Progetto PIC18F67J60 e Controller Ethernet ENC28J60

MessaggioInviato: 14 gen 2012, 1:39
da Prog93
Voglio realizzare un progetto per l'esame di maturità... si tratta di un circuito dotato di RFid (ID-12 della Innovations technology) il quale rileva il codice del tag, e lo manda al PIC sopracitato, e questo deve essere in grado di spedire il codice via ethernet su internet, per fare ciò ho pensato di usare l'ENC28J60, l'interfaccia SPI, e lo stack TCP/IP della Microchip... Ho già diversi sorgenti di esempio per l'ethernet controller, ma ora devo entrare più nel dettaglio...

Volevo sapere che complilatore C mi consigliereste di usare (in versione lite) C18, o HI-TECH, con MPLAB?
Quali accorgimenti dovrei tenere in considerazione per un progetto del genere?
Dove posso trovare degli esempi utili per non cominciare da zero?

Sono graditi consigli e chiarimenti... :ok:

Grazie in anticipo! :-)

Re: Progetto PIC18F67J60 e Controller Ethernet ENC28J60

MessaggioInviato: 14 gen 2012, 1:52
da TardoFreak
C18 perché non ha limitazione di codice.
Per il resto ... ti auguro buona fortuna. Ne avrai tanto bisogno. :cool:

Re: Progetto PIC18F67J60 e Controller Ethernet ENC28J60

MessaggioInviato: 14 gen 2012, 17:56
da Prog93
Grazie per la risposta, e anche per l'augurio... anche se a questo punto mi occorrerebbe qualcosa di più materiale... :lol:

Re: Progetto PIC18F67J60 e Controller Ethernet ENC28J60

MessaggioInviato: 14 gen 2012, 18:26
da Paolino
Ok. Dato che il progetto è il tuo, ti richiediamo un minimo di impegno. Come prima cosa stendi specifiche chiare: più chiare saranno per te, più "facile" sarà affrontare il progetto. In secondo luogo butta giù uno schema di massima che poi verrà affinato.

Ciao.

Paolo.

Re: Progetto PIC18F67J60 e Controller Ethernet ENC28J60

MessaggioInviato: 14 gen 2012, 18:57
da Prog93
Certo il progetto lo voglio realizzare io, ma non ho mai programmato un PIC da solo, ho ricevuto solamente delle spiegazioni a scuola, e vedendo dei progetti simili su internet mi sono accorto che non è troppo facile.. xD
Per la parte firmware non penso ci siano molte complessità, quello che mi preoccupa è la progettazione fisica, la scelta dei resistori e condensatori ecc... Se qualcuno mi potesse dare delle dritte sul come gestire la scelta dei componenti ne sarei molto grato, anche perché nel progetto parto quasi da zero... #-o

Re: Progetto PIC18F67J60 e Controller Ethernet ENC28J60

MessaggioInviato: 14 gen 2012, 19:11
da Paolino
Accidenti, se parti quasi da zero, la cosa si fa piuttosto complicata! Soprattutto per te! #-o
Tieni conto che nei forum (e in questo forum "la regola" non è differente dagli altri) di solito si dà un aiuto, raramente si fa un progetto complesso, per intero. I motivi sono molti: il tempo, il fatto che l'esemplare sotto studio di solito è in mano ad una sola persona partecipante alla discussione, difficoltà comunicative, eccetera.

Se proprio sei digiuno, consiglio la scelta di un progetto più semplice! Imparare a programmare un microcontrollore per affrontare un progetto così ambizioso è un po' come chiedere a un bambino di imparare a camminare avendo come obiettivo la scalata del Monte Bianco... :? Prima si impara a camminare, poi a correre e poi a scalare le montagne. Non è che i bambini dei montanari imparano a camminare in modo differente!

C'è un'alternativa, ma è "costosa": l'acquisto di una demoboard, come ad esempio questa, e sviluppare il codice.

Ma, se mi dai retta, prima impara a camminare...!

Ciao.

Paolo.

Re: Progetto PIC18F67J60 e Controller Ethernet ENC28J60

MessaggioInviato: 14 gen 2012, 19:30
da Prog93
Grazie dei consigli :-o però oramai sono determinato, e ho gia speso tanto tempo per informarmi su questo tipo di progetto, comunque lo faccio con un mio compagno, per cui 2 teste sono meglio di una, cercherò di farmi aiutare il piu possibile dal profe, e di sturiare le basi dei PIC... poi andrà come andrà... :roll:

Re: Progetto PIC18F67J60 e Controller Ethernet ENC28J60

MessaggioInviato: 14 gen 2012, 23:46
da TardoFreak
Senti, io te lo dico perché te lo devo dire: andrà male. :(

Scusa la franchezza. sorry

Re: Progetto PIC18F67J60 e Controller Ethernet ENC28J60

MessaggioInviato: 15 gen 2012, 9:55
da Paolino
Ammiro la tua determinazione, Foto UtenteProg93: merce rara di questi tempi, nei ragazzi della tua età. Ma ribadisco il mio consiglio: vai avanti per gradi. Altrimenti le delusioni per essere incappati in ostacoli (a prima vista) insormontabili, saranno cocenti... :cry:

Ciao.

Paolo.

Re: Progetto PIC18F67J60 e Controller Ethernet ENC28J60

MessaggioInviato: 16 gen 2012, 22:45
da Prog93
mmm... si ho notato di essermi sbilanciato trp, mi conviene un PIC normale a 40 pin, volevo realizzare una cosa del genere...
http://eprojects.ljcv.net/2010/08/inter ... ochip.html

In questo progetto si utilizza un pic18f4620, ma si consiglia un pic18f4685, per la maggiore memoria di programma... che ne pensate? Su questi PIC non ho trovato molto materiale su internet però... :?